What grade do most kids get held back?

The United States and Canada both use grade retention. In the U.S., six-year-old students are most likely to be retained, with another spike around the age of 12. In particular, some large schools have a transitional classroom, sometimes called “kindergarten 2”, for six year olds who are not reading ready.

Can you fail kindergarten?

Children don’t flunk kindergarten. In the past, some students (with parent agreement) repeated kindergarten as they were considered not ready, developmentally, for the first grade. Currently, retaining a student is not considered “best practice.”

Should my gifted child skip a grade?

For many gifted children, grade acceleration is beneficial. But, for some children, skipping a grade can be harmful to their social and emotional development. Being away from age group peers and automatically viewed as the “whiz kid” has the potential to lead to bullying or other emotional damage.

Should you hold back your child kindergarten?

Repeating Kindergarten: The Research There is a vast amount of scientific research showing that children do not benefit by being held back in grade school. But there is very little out there about holding a child back in kindergarten to wait another year before starting first grade.

Is your child being held back in a Grade?

Grade retention is far from being simply an academic issue. Especially for your older child, it’s a social and emotional issue that needs careful addressing. Repeating a grade is often stigmatizing for children, many of whom tend to brand themselves as failures; in fact, studies show being held back can be the stress equivalent of losing a parent.

Does being held back in high school delay graduation?

Being held back did delay students’ graduation from high school by 0.63 years, but being older for their grade did not reduce their probability of graduating or receiving a regular diploma. “It is important to note that we are not saying that the students who were retained in Florida were clearly better off as a result,” says West.

Is it possible to graduate high school in 3 years?

In high school, students are not retained but grade level is based on number of credit hours earned. There is the possibility of graduating in 3 years but you may need the school’s permission to do so. The bigger issue is why you were retained.
